Agreement For Sale Of Mortgaged House - Legal Draft

Home Forms View

Category : Agreements Sale

This Agreement made at

......................... on this ................ day of ...................,

2000, between A, son of ...................... resident of

...................... (hereinafter called the vendor) of the FIRST PART, B,

son of....................... resident of .................................

(hereinafter called the purchaser) of the SECOND PART and C son of

..................... resident of.......................................

(hereinafter called the mortgagee) of the THIRD PART.Whereas the vendor is

absolutely seized and possessed of or well and sufficiently entitled to the

house more fully described in the Schedule hereunder written, hereinafter

referred to as the "said house";And Whereas the said

house is mortgaged with Shri ................. for the sum of Rs.

...................... pursuant to a deed of mortgage executed between the

vendor and Shri ............................. on the other part and a sum of

Rs. ....................... is due from the vendor to the said mortgagee.And Whereas the

vendor has agreed to sell and purchaser has agreed to purchase the said house

an the terms and conditions mentioned below:it is hereby agreed

between the parties as follows:1.

The

vendor will sell and the purchaser will purchase all that house No.

.................... Road ............... more particularly described in the

Schedule hereunder written for a sum of Rs. ............... out of which the

purchaser has paid Rs. ................. to the vendor as earnest money (the

receipt of which sum, the vendor hereby acknowledges) and out of balance price

to be paid by the purchaser, he shall pay Rs . .................. on or before

the date of ......................... and the remaining sum of Rs.

.................. will be paid to the vendor at the time of registration of

the sale deed.2.

The

mortgagee's advocate shall deliver the documents of title of the said house to

the purchaser's advocate against his accountable receipt within ..................

days from the date of this agreement for investigation of title.It is hereby declared

that delivering the documents of title by the mortgagee to the purchaser's

advocate will not affect the mortgage of the mortgagee and mortgage on the said

house will continue until the full payment of the mortgage money is made to the

mortgagee by the vendor or the purchaser.1.2.3.

The

said house will be purchased by the purchaser without any encumbrance,

easements, restrictions and rights affecting the same.4.

The

purchase shall be completed within a period of .............. months from the

date of this Agreement. The purchaser shall send the draft conveyance deed to

the vendor a fortnight prior to the date of the intended execution and after

approval thereof by the vendor, the purchaser shall get the same ready for

execution by the vendor. All expenses for preparation of the conveyance deed,

cost of stamp and registration charges and all other out of pocket expenses

shall be borne by the purchaser.5.

The

mortgagee shall discharge the mortgage on the back of the mortgage deed on

payment of Rs. ........... by the purchaser and return the mortgage deed duly

discharged to the purchaser. It is hereby agreed and confirmed that the sale

deed shall not be executed, unless the mortgage on the said house is discharged

by the mortgagee.6.

If

the vendor's title to the said house is not approved by purchaser's advocate,

the vendor shall refund the earnest money to the purchaser within

................. days from the date of intimation by the purchaser about the

non-approval of the title by his advocate. If the vendor does not refund the

earnest money within................ days, he shall be liable to pay interest @

Rs ................ per month upto the date of payment of earnest money. In the

case of non-approval of title by the purchaser's advocate, the purchaser's

advocate shall return the documents of title of the said house to the

mortgagee's advocate.7.

If

the purchaser commits breach of this agreement, the vendor shall forfeit the

earnest money paid by the purchaser and the purchaser shall also be liable to

pay to the vendor the deficiency and expenses of resale of the said house.8.

If

the vendor commits breach of the agreement, he shall refund the earnest money

to the purchaser and he shall also be liable to pay Rs . .................. to

the Purchaser by way of liquidated damages.9.

The

vendor shall execute conveyance deed in favour of the purchaser or his nominee,

as the purchaser may require.10.

The

vendor shall hand over the vacant possession of the said house and documents of

title in respect thereof to the purchaser before registration of the conveyance

deed.11.

The

vendor shall at his own cost obtain certificate under section 230A, Income-tax

Act, and any other permission or no objection from Government, Municipal or

statutory authority for the completion of conveyance deed.12.

Notwithstanding

anything contained in clauses 7 and 8 hereof, the parties will have the right

for specific performance of this Agreement.The Schedule above

referred toIN WITNESS WHEREOF

the parties have set their hands to this Agreement on the date and year first

hereinabove written.Signed and delivered

by Shri A,the within named

VendorSigned and delivered

by Shri B,the within named

PurchaserSigned and delivered

by Shri C,the within named

MortgageeWITNESSES;1.2.
